Jamhuri Day– December 12, 2021

Jamhuri Day, also called Independence Day, is one of the most important nationwide vacations in Kenya. Jamhuri Day is observed on December 12 every year, and December 13 is also a day off for a lot of organizations. December 12 is likewise the date when Kenya got its self-reliance from Terrific Britain in 1963.

HISTORY OF JAMHURI DAY
The very first colonists from Europe that made their way to Kenya were German. In 1890, the area came under the control of the Imperial British East Africa Business, and Kenya was part of the British East Africa protectorate till it was acknowledged as a British nest in 1920. The very first direct elections took place in 1957, where the Kenya African National Union was led by Jomo Kenyatta, forming the very first government.

Kenya was under British rule considering that the late 19th century, and the country officially ended up being a British colony in 1920. During these uprisings, the country was plunged into a state of emergency through most of the years. The Mau uprisings assisted Kenya acquire some social and economic concessions.

Kenya gained independence on December 12, 1963. Jomo Kenyatta was Kenya’s very first president. Jamhuri Day is a day of national, cultural, and historic significance in Kenya.

JAMHURI DAY FAQS.
Where is Kenya found in Africa?
Kenya is a country in Eastern Africa. It lies in between Somalia to the northeast and Tanzania to the south. Its other surrounding nations are Ethiopia and South Sudan to the north and Uganda to the west.

How huge is Kenya compared to the remainder of the world?
At 224,081 sq miles, Kenya is the world’s 48th biggest country by total location. With a population of more than 52.2 million people, Kenya is the 27th most populated country.

How do Kenyans celebrate Jamhuri Day?
Self-reliance Day is likewise marked by cultural celebrations commemorating Kenya’s distinct cultural identity. Kenya’s flag is hung all over the capital city of Nairobi.
